Mercurial > lcfOS
comparison python/testasm.py @ 234:83781bd10fdb
wip
author | Windel Bouwman |
---|---|
date | Sun, 14 Jul 2013 19:29:21 +0200 |
parents | e621e3ba78d2 |
children | 8786811a5a59 |
comparison
equal
deleted
inserted
replaced
233:d3dccf12ca88 | 234:83781bd10fdb |
---|---|
192 | 192 |
193 def testStrSpRel(self): | 193 def testStrSpRel(self): |
194 self.feed('str r0, [sp + 4]') | 194 self.feed('str r0, [sp + 4]') |
195 self.check('0190') | 195 self.check('0190') |
196 | 196 |
197 def testLdrPcRel(self): | |
198 self.feed('ldr r1, henkie') | |
199 self.feed('dcd 1') | |
200 self.feed('henkie: dcd 2') | |
201 self.check('04490100000002000000') | |
202 | |
197 def testCmpRegReg(self): | 203 def testCmpRegReg(self): |
198 self.feed('cmp r0, r1') | 204 self.feed('cmp r0, r1') |
199 self.check('8842') | 205 self.check('8842') |
200 | 206 |
201 def testLeftShit(self): | 207 def testLeftShit(self): |